Summary

Blackfeet Water Rights Settlement Act of 2015 Authorizes, ratifies, and confirms the Blackfeet-Montana water rights Compact to the extent it does not conflict with this Act. Requires the Blackfeet Tribe of the Blackfeet Indian Reservation of Montana and the Fort Belknap Indian Community to enter into an agreement for the exercise of the respective water rights on the respective reservations of the Tribe and the Community in the Milk River. Requires the Department of the Interior to contract with the Tribe for the delivery of 5,000 acre-feet per year of the St. Mary River water right through Milk River Project facilities to the Tribe or an entity specified by it.Requires specified appraisal and feasibility studies regarding the management and development of water supplies in the St. Mary River Basin and Milk River Basin. Requires the Bureau of Reclamation to implement the Swift Current Creek Bank Stabilization Project and offer to enter into an agreement with the Tribe to resolve all issues regarding federal Milk River Project property interests located on tribal lands. Gives the Tribe, subject to specified limitations and only if the St. Mary Storage Unit of the Milk River Project is rehabilitated, the exclusive right to develop and market hydroelectric power from the Unit. Directs Interior to allocate to the Tribe 50,000 acre-feet per year of water stored in Lake Elwell for use by the Tribe for any beneficial purpose on or off the Reservation. Authorizes the Tribe to enter into leases or other agreements for the use of that water, provided its use occurs within the Missouri River Basin and the agreement does not permanently alienate the allocation. Requires the Bureau of Reclamation, with respect to the Blackfeet Irrigation Project, to carry out: (1) deferred maintenance; (2) Four Horns Dam safety improvements; and (3) rehabilitation and enhancement of the Four Horns Feeder Canal, Dam, and Reservoir in accordance with the Birch Creek Agreement. Requires the Bureau of Reclamation to construct the water diversion and delivery features of the MR&I System. Requires the Tribe, upon request by Interior, to grant, at no cost to the United States, such easements and rights-of-way over tribal land necessary for the construction of the irrigation activities related to the Blackfeet Irrigation Project and for the design and construction of the MR&I System. Prescribes requirements and funding for the Blackfeet Water, Storage, and Development Project. Requires the tribal water rights to be held in trust by the United States for the Tribe and its allottees. Requires the Tribe to enact a tribal water code, subject to Interior approval, in accordance with the Compact and this Act. Establishes the Blackfeet Settlement Trust Fund. Confirms the instream flow water rights of the Tribe in the Lewis and Clark National Forest and Glacier National Park. Requires the Tribe to waive and release water rights claims against Montana and the United States in return for recognition of the tribal water rights and other benefits set forth in the Compact and this Act. Declares this Act repealed if Interior fails to take certain actions by January 22, 2025.
